Hi can anyone help?,
I'm trying to setup a server for my team but am encountering problems. I set up the server on configurator and then went to launcher. Launcher doesn't tell me there is a problem, this is what shows up.... [05 Aug 2009 17:01:54,237] INFO: Loading ServerLauncher config: /Users/AJM/Altitude/servers/launcher_config.xml [05 Aug 2009 17:01:54,282] INFO: Loading ban list: /Users/AJM/Altitude/servers/ban_list.xml [05 Aug 2009 17:01:54,299] INFO: Resolving update server vapor.nimblygames.com [05 Aug 2009 17:01:54,864] INFO: Update server is 205.234.203.34:31383 [05 Aug 2009 17:01:54,865] INFO: Initializing update module on local UDP port 27275 [05 Aug 2009 17:01:55,298] INFO: Initial update check result: LOCAL_VERSION_IS_UP_TO_DATE [05 Aug 2009 17:01:55,422] INFO: Initializing '{BM}-Mothership' on UDP port 27276 [05 Aug 2009 17:01:55,426] INFO: Starting server on port 27276 [05 Aug 2009 17:01:55,683] INFO: Changing map: tbd_hills [05 Aug 2009 17:01:56,308] INFO: Starting 1 game servers [05 Aug 2009 17:01:56,308] INFO: Starting update poller [05 Aug 2009 17:01:56,317] INFO: [Data Transfer Since Launch] Outgoing: 0.000 GB, Incoming: 0.000 GB [05 Aug 2009 17:01:56,675] INFO: Update check result: LOCAL_VERSION_IS_UP_TO_DATE, free memory: 38.3 / 63.6 MB [05 Aug 2009 17:01:57,327] INFO: valid server hello response; remote IP is 212.183.134.130:29535 This is as far as it goes, when i go on to Altitude my server doesn't show in the list i think its unresponsive. Is this a port problem due to my firewall? if so how do i tackle this? Im using a Mac OSX 10.4.11 Intel Dual core, 2gb RAM. Please help!!! eeeek. ![]() Thanks {BM}classicallad |

You need to set up port forwarding on your router to allow incoming connections.
In this case you need to log in to your router and forward the server port (UDP 27276) to your machine's local IP Address. You may find the guides at http://portforward.com to be a useful reference. |

Find that router on the list, and click on it. The new page probably will not have Altitude in the game list. INSTEAD look at the paragraphs on top. The last paragraph should say something like "If you do not see the program you are forwarding ports for, be sure to visit our Default Guide for this router". Click on Default Guide, and follow the instructions. |
